Eamonn Holmes pays tribute to Ruth Langsford following emotional This Morning return

Eamonn Holmes has shared a moving tribute to his wife and This Morning co-host Ruth Langsford following her return to TV after taking time off following the death of her sister Julia.

The ITV host posted a sweet photo to Instagram on Monday to coincide with their joint appearance on the brunch time show.

Holmes said in his post: "My partner is back in business.

“Please join us for This Morning on @itv from 10.30 .... for the next 7 , yes I said SEVEN, Weeks."

This is the first time Langsford has made a television appearance since she announced that her sister passed away aged 62 following a “very long illness”

The presenter, 59, who took a back seat from her on-screen duties last month to grieve for her sibling, resumed her role beside Holmes on Monday.

Although Langsford did not touch on her sister's death, her husband told her at the at the start of the show: “It's very nice to see you back, darling.”

She replied with “thank you very much”, before starting the first show of their seven week summer stint covering for regular hosts Holly Willoughby and Phillip Schofield.

As his wife struggled to hold back tears, Holmes told viewers: “Your messages have been a great support, not only to Ruth but also to me."

On June 20, Ruth told fans she had been left 'broken' following the death of her sister.

Announcing the sad news on Twitter, Langsford wrote: “My lovely Sis Julia has sadly died after a very long illness. My heart is completely broken. She was the kindest and most gentle soul and I will miss her forever.

“As I am sure you will appreciate I need to take time to grieve with my family. Thank you for your understanding.”

At the time of the death a source told The Sun: “Ruth is utterly heartbroken and devastated to have found out her beloved sister Julia has died.

"Julia had been unwell for quite some time but this has shaken Ruth to the core.

"Eammon and son Jack are comforting her at home but Ruth is in deep shock. It’s absolutely heartbreaking for the whole family."

During Friday's episode of the ITV daytime show, main presenters Phil and Holly confirmed Ruth would be returning as they take a two-month break for the summer.
